Bug 313542

Summary: plasma desktop crashes
Product: [Unmaintained] plasma4 Reporter: troy R <troyrileys8709>
Component: generalAssignee: Plasma Bugs List <plasma-bugs>
Status: RESOLVED DUPLICATE    
Severity: crash    
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Ubuntu   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description troy R 2013-01-20 03:45:12 UTC
Application: plasma-desktop (0.4)
KDE Platform Version: 4.9.97
Qt Version: 4.8.3
Operating System: Linux 3.5.0-22-generic x86_64
Distribution: Ubuntu 12.10

-- Information about the crash:
- What I was doing when the application crashed: i login and it crashes  from the start, the screen is black and it stays that way

The crash can be reproduced every time.

-- Backtrace:
Application: Plasma Desktop Shell (plasma-desktop), signal: Segmentation fault
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1".
[Current thread is 1 (Thread 0x7fabb352b780 (LWP 2086))]

Thread 4 (Thread 0x7faba4468700 (LWP 2087)):
#0  pthread_cond_wait@@GLIBC_2.3.2 () at ../nptl/sysdeps/unix/sysv/linux/x86_64/pthread_cond_wait.S:162
#1  0x00007fabc0599cd7 in ?? () from /usr/lib/x86_64-linux-gnu/libQtScript.so.4
#2  0x00007fabc0599d09 in ?? () from /usr/lib/x86_64-linux-gnu/libQtScript.so.4
#3  0x00007fabbac47e9a in start_thread (arg=0x7faba4468700) at pthread_create.c:308
#4  0x00007fabc68adcbd in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#5  0x0000000000000000 in ?? ()

Thread 3 (Thread 0x7fab97c6a700 (LWP 2090)):
#0  0x00007fabc68a08bd in read () at ../sysdeps/unix/syscall-template.S:82
#1  0x00007fabba58515f in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007fabba548914 in g_main_context_check ()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007fabba548d22 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#4  0x00007fabba548ea4 in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#5  0x00007fabc3542c16 in QEventDispatcherGlib::processEvents (this=0x7fab880008c0, flags=...) at kernel/qeventdispatcher_glib.cpp:426
#6  0x00007fabc35132bf in QEventLoop::processEvents (this=this@entry=0x7fab97c69dd0, flags=...) at kernel/qeventloop.cpp:149
#7  0x00007fabc3513548 in QEventLoop::exec (this=0x7fab97c69dd0, flags=...) at kernel/qeventloop.cpp:204
#8  0x00007fabc3414b10 in QThread::exec (this=<optimized out>) at thread/qthread.cpp:501
#9  0x00007fabc34f39af in QInotifyFileSystemWatcherEngine::run (this=0x3311ac0) at io/qfilesystemwatcher_inotify.cpp:248
#10 0x00007fabc3417aec in QThreadPrivate::start (arg=0x3311ac0) at thread/qthread_unix.cpp:338
#11 0x00007fabbac47e9a in start_thread (arg=0x7fab97c6a700) at pthread_create.c:308
#12 0x00007fabc68adcbd in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#13 0x0000000000000000 in ?? ()

Thread 2 (Thread 0x7fab96dd4700 (LWP 2091)):
#0  0x00007fabc68a2303 in __GI___poll (fds=<optimized out>, nfds=<optimized out>, timeout=<optimized out>) at ../sysdeps/unix/sysv/linux/poll.c:87
#1  0x00007fabba548d84 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#2  0x00007fabba548ea4 in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#3  0x00007fabc3542c16 in QEventDispatcherGlib::processEvents (this=0x7fab8c0008c0, flags=...) at kernel/qeventdispatcher_glib.cpp:426
#4  0x00007fabc35132bf in QEventLoop::processEvents (this=this@entry=0x7fab96dd3dd0, flags=...) at kernel/qeventloop.cpp:149
#5  0x00007fabc3513548 in QEventLoop::exec (this=0x7fab96dd3dd0, flags=...) at kernel/qeventloop.cpp:204
#6  0x00007fabc3414b10 in QThread::exec (this=<optimized out>) at thread/qthread.cpp:501
#7  0x00007fabc34f39af in QInotifyFileSystemWatcherEngine::run (this=0x3360800) at io/qfilesystemwatcher_inotify.cpp:248
#8  0x00007fabc3417aec in QThreadPrivate::start (arg=0x3360800) at thread/qthread_unix.cpp:338
#9  0x00007fabbac47e9a in start_thread (arg=0x7fab96dd4700) at pthread_create.c:308
#10 0x00007fabc68adcbd in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#11 0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7fabb352b780 (LWP 2086)):
[KCrash Handler]
#6  0x00007faba783c715 in QHash<void*, PyQtProxy*>::duplicateNode(QHashData::Node*, void*) () from /usr/lib/python2.7/dist-packages/PyQt4/QtCore.so
#7  0x00007fabc343383f in QHashData::detach_helper2 (this=0x2936bf0, node_duplicate=0x7faba783c710 <QHash<void*, PyQtProxy*>::duplicateNode(QHashData::Node*, void*)>, node_delete=0x7faba783c700 <QHash<void*, PyQtProxy*>::deleteNode2(QHashData::Node*)>, nodeSize=<optimized out>, nodeAlign=8) at tools/qhash.cpp:239
#8  0x00007faba783c86a in QHash<void*, PyQtProxy*>::detach_helper() () from /usr/lib/python2.7/dist-packages/PyQt4/QtCore.so
#9  0x00007faba78408ab in sipQtFindSipslot () from /usr/lib/python2.7/dist-packages/PyQt4/QtCore.so
#10 0x00007faba74854fe in sipWrapper_traverse (arg=0x0, visit=0x7faba7e8b6f0 <visit_decref.49342>, self=0x2b05440) at /build/buildd/sip4-4.13.3/siplib/siplib.c:9709
#11 sipWrapper_traverse (self=0x2b05440, visit=0x7faba7e8b6f0 <visit_decref.49342>, arg=0x0) at /build/buildd/sip4-4.13.3/siplib/siplib.c:9690
#12 0x00007faba7e91817 in collect.49477 (generation=generation@entry=2) at ../Modules/gcmodule.c:385
#13 0x00007faba7d58a28 in PyGC_Collect.part.7 () at ../Modules/gcmodule.c:1440
#14 PyGC_Collect () at ../Modules/gcmodule.c:1432
#15 0x00007faba7d5ff96 in Py_Finalize.part.3 () at ../Python/pythonrun.c:444
#16 Py_Finalize () at ../Python/pythonrun.c:400
#17 0x00007faba8231ab5 in KPythonPluginFactory::~KPythonPluginFactory (this=0x27afe30, __in_chrg=<optimized out>) at ../../kpythonpluginfactory/kpythonpluginfactory.cpp:262
#18 0x00007faba8231b19 in KPythonPluginFactory::~KPythonPluginFactory (this=0x27afe30, __in_chrg=<optimized out>) at ../../kpythonpluginfactory/kpythonpluginfactory.cpp:268
#19 0x00007fabc352f8a4 in QObjectCleanupHandler::clear (this=this@entry=0x229d4d0) at kernel/qobjectcleanuphandler.cpp:140
#20 0x00007fabc352f8e4 in QObjectCleanupHandler::~QObjectCleanupHandler (this=0x229d4d0, __in_chrg=<optimized out>) at kernel/qobjectcleanuphandler.cpp:86
#21 0x00007fabc352f939 in QObjectCleanupHandler::~QObjectCleanupHandler (this=0x229d4d0, __in_chrg=<optimized out>) at kernel/qobjectcleanuphandler.cpp:87
#22 0x00007fabc67f5901 in __run_exit_handlers (status=1, listp=0x7fabc6b726a8 <__exit_funcs>, run_list_atexit=true) at exit.c:78
#23 0x00007fabc67f5985 in __GI_exit (status=<optimized out>, status@entry=1) at exit.c:100
#24 0x00007fab94b32292 in gdk_x_error (display=<optimized out>, error=<optimized out>) at /build/buildd/gtk+2.0-2.24.13/gdk/x11/gdkmain-x11.c:490
#25 0x00007fabc4cbd4f6 in _XError (dpy=dpy@entry=0x20d6ce0, rep=rep@entry=0x356e170) at ../../src/XlibInt.c:1583
#26 0x00007fabc4cba741 in handle_error (dpy=dpy@entry=0x20d6ce0, err=err@entry=0x356e170, in_XReply=in_XReply@entry=1) at ../../src/xcb_io.c:212
#27 0x00007fabc4cba785 in handle_response (dpy=dpy@entry=0x20d6ce0, response=0x356e170, in_XReply=in_XReply@entry=1) at ../../src/xcb_io.c:324
#28 0x00007fabc4cbb378 in _XReply (dpy=dpy@entry=0x20d6ce0, rep=rep@entry=0x7fff3978f150, extra=extra@entry=0, discard=discard@entry=1) at ../../src/xcb_io.c:626
#29 0x00007fabc4c9fd29 in XGetGeometry (dpy=0x20d6ce0, d=35652009, root=0x7fff3978f1e8, x=0x7fff3978f1d0, y=0x7fff3978f1d4, width=0x7fff3978f1d8, height=0x7fff3978f1dc, borderWidth=0x7fff3978f1e0, depth=0x7fff3978f1e4) at ../../src/GetGeom.c:47
#30 0x00007fabc29a55e6 in QPixmap::fromX11Pixmap (pixmap=35652009, mode=QPixmap::ExplicitlyShared) at image/qpixmap_x11.cpp:2386
#31 0x00007fabc640c26b in DialogShadows::Private::initEmptyPixmap (this=this@entry=0x2240a70, size=...) at ../../plasma/private/dialogshadows.cpp:166
#32 0x00007fabc640c97d in DialogShadows::Private::setupPixmaps (this=this@entry=0x2240a70) at ../../plasma/private/dialogshadows.cpp:187
#33 0x00007fabc640e2f0 in DialogShadows::Private::updateShadows (this=0x2240a70) at ../../plasma/private/dialogshadows.cpp:137
#34 0x00007fabc3529f5f in QMetaObject::activate (sender=0x22401d0, m=<optimized out>, local_signal_index=<optimized out>, argv=0x0) at kernel/qobject.cpp:3547
#35 0x00007fabc6462caf in themeChanged (this=0x22409f0) at ../../plasma/svg.cpp:618
#36 Plasma::SvgPrivate::themeChanged (this=0x22409f0) at ../../plasma/svg.cpp:601
#37 0x00007fabc6462f09 in qt_static_metacall (_a=<optimized out>, _id=<optimized out>, _o=<optimized out>, _c=<optimized out>) at ./svg.moc:114
#38 Plasma::Svg::qt_static_metacall (_o=0xd8, _c=52004480, _id=-961075392, _a=0x7fabc6b72750 <main_arena+16>) at ./svg.moc:106
#39 0x00007fabc3529f5f in QMetaObject::activate (sender=0x20bdc90, m=<optimized out>, local_signal_index=<optimized out>, argv=0x0) at kernel/qobject.cpp:3547
#40 0x00007fabc646b81b in Plasma::ThemePrivate::notifyOfChanged (this=0x2141720) at ../../plasma/theme.cpp:366
#41 0x00007fabc646b9f9 in qt_static_metacall (_a=<optimized out>, _id=<optimized out>, _o=<optimized out>, _c=<optimized out>) at ./theme.moc:102
#42 Plasma::Theme::qt_static_metacall (_o=<optimized out>, _c=<optimized out>, _id=<optimized out>, _a=<optimized out>) at ./theme.moc:88
#43 0x00007fabc3529f5f in QMetaObject::activate (sender=0x2204010, m=<optimized out>, local_signal_index=<optimized out>, argv=0x0) at kernel/qobject.cpp:3547
#44 0x00007fabc352926c in QObject::event (this=0x2204010, e=<optimized out>) at kernel/qobject.cpp:1157
#45 0x00007fabc28bbe9c in QApplicationPrivate::notify_helper (this=this@entry=0x20a9eb0, receiver=receiver@entry=0x2204010, e=e@entry=0x7fff3978feb0) at kernel/qapplication.cpp:4562
#46 0x00007fabc28c030a in QApplication::notify (this=0x20a65b0, receiver=0x2204010, e=0x7fff3978feb0) at kernel/qapplication.cpp:4423
#47 0x00007fabc41cd626 in KApplication::notify (this=0x20a65b0, receiver=0x2204010, event=0x7fff3978feb0) at ../../kdeui/kernel/kapplication.cpp:311
#48 0x00007fabc351456e in QCoreApplication::notifyInternal (this=0x20a65b0, receiver=0x2204010, event=0x7fff3978feb0) at kernel/qcoreapplication.cpp:915
#49 0x00007fabc3545462 in sendEvent (event=0x7fff3978feb0, receiver=<optimized out>)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:231
#50 QTimerInfoList::activateTimers (this=0x20ac660) at kernel/qeventdispatcher_unix.cpp:611
#51 0x00007fabc3542584 in timerSourceDispatch (source=<optimized out>) at kernel/qeventdispatcher_glib.cpp:186
#52 timerSourceDispatch (source=<optimized out>) at kernel/qeventdispatcher_glib.cpp:180
#53 0x00007fabba548ab5 in g_main_context_dispatch ()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#54 0x00007fabba548de8 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#55 0x00007fabba548ea4 in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#56 0x00007fabc3542bf6 in QEventDispatcherGlib::processEvents (this=0x201ead0, flags=...) at kernel/qeventdispatcher_glib.cpp:424
#57 0x00007fabc2960c1e in QGuiEventDispatcherGlib::processEvents (this=<optimized out>, flags=...) at kernel/qguieventdispatcher_glib.cpp:204
#58 0x00007fabc35132bf in QEventLoop::processEvents (this=this@entry=0x7fff39790120, flags=...) at kernel/qeventloop.cpp:149
#59 0x00007fabc3513548 in QEventLoop::exec (this=0x7fff39790120, flags=...) at kernel/qeventloop.cpp:204
#60 0x00007fabc3518708 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:1187
#61 0x00007fabc6bb61b1 in kdemain (argc=1, argv=0x7fff39790418) at ../../../../plasma/desktop/shell/main.cpp:126
#62 0x00007fabc67db76d in __libc_start_main (main=0x4006a0 <main(int, char**)>, argc=1, ubp_av=0x7fff39790418, init=<optimized out>, fini=<optimized out>, rtld_fini=<optimized out>, stack_end=0x7fff39790408) at libc-start.c:226
#63 0x00000000004006d1 in _start ()

This bug may be a duplicate of or related to bug 310432.

Possible duplicates by query: bug 312814, bug 310432, bug 310431, bug 305004, bug 292732.

Reported using DrKonqi
Comment 1 Martin Flöser 2013-01-20 15:51:20 UTC

*** This bug has been marked as a duplicate of bug 292064 ***